Tin IV Bromide SnBr

Tin IV) bromide, SnBr4. M.p. 33°C, b.p. 203 C, prepared from the elements. Fonns many complexes, including [SnBr ] ions. [Pg.398]

There is a rapid exchange of halogens in mixtures of tin(IV) chloride, bromide and iodide, and Raman spectra have shown the presence of all possible molecules of formula SnBr I Cl4, in such a mixtureis-. ... [Pg.86]
